Question 277801: I need help with this problem
The larger of two numbers is 8 more than four times the smaller. If the larger is increased by four times the smaller, the result is 40. Find the two numbers. Answer by checkley77(12844) (Show Source):
You can put this solution on YOUR website! Y=4X+8 OR
Y-4X=8
Y+4X=40 ADD.
--------------
2Y=48
Y=48/2
Y=24 ANS.
24=4X+8
4X=24-8
4X=16
X=16/4
X=4 ANS.
PROOF:
24+4*4=40
24+16=40
40=40
